MySQL是一種關系型數據庫管理系統,是目前使用最廣泛的開源數據庫之一。主鍵是MySQL中的一個重要概念,下面我們來了解一下主鍵的相關知識。
主鍵是指在表中唯一標識每一行數據的一列或一組列。通過主鍵,我們可以方便地找到想要的數據,同時避免了數據冗余和重復。主鍵列一般會自動創建索引,提高數據的訪問效率。
在MySQL中,主鍵有兩種創建方式:
1.在創建表時添加主鍵約束 CREATE TABLE 表名 ( 列名1 數據類型 PRIMARY KEY, 列名2 數據類型, ... ); 2.在已經存在的表中添加主鍵約束 ALTER TABLE 表名 ADD PRIMARY KEY (列名);
需要注意的是,一個表只能擁有一個主鍵,而且主鍵列的值不能為空。
在實際應用中,我們通常會選擇一個本身具有唯一性的列作為主鍵列。比如,可以選擇用戶賬號、文章編號、訂單號、學生學號等作為主鍵列。如果沒有合適的候選列,也可以使用自增長的整數作為主鍵。
主鍵是MySQL中一個十分重要的概念,它不僅能夠保證數據的準確性和完整性,還能大大提高數據庫的訪問效率。
上一篇app vue ui
下一篇css元素邊框教程